1.

I would assume around 2k people and it seems it is increasing. I see new people every day....

 

2.

On this server the game is as less pay to win as it ever has been before. The staff is constanly working on getting rid of as much pay to win as possible. You still need insurance scrolls. You can buy them with ingame gold from other players though, same for all other item mall stuff.

 

Plus on this server here are lots and lots of events in which you can get free IM stuff and costumes.

 

For PvP you need enchanted gear, that hasn't changed. For PVE you don't need more than a +4 on everything except you want to farm Elga (end boss of the game). In that case you need enchanted gear too, but like I said you can buy everything you need from other players with ingame gold. There are lots of trusted IM sellers (selling IM stuff for gold) in the game waiting for their next customer. Many important IM items can be bought for gold in the open market too.

As they said the population in game is decent, but not as any other highly renowned games.

There is no item in the game (which you can buy with IM) that you can not get with gold via market, trade, mail, or buying IM gifts from others.

Money is primarily used to speed things up. The only difference between a person that spent 100$ and another who spent 0 is that the one who spent money has more gear that you can get later on before you do. It's like a ticket to the future that won't change. At the end you both will have the same thing, just one method is faster obviously.
